Subject: Re: [PATCH v6 18/21] fanotify: Emit generic error info type for error event
Date: Mon, 16 Aug 2021 18:23:01 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210816162301.GI30215@quack2.suse.cz>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20210812214010.3197279-19-krisman@collabora.com>
On Thu 12-08-21 17:40:07, Gabriel Krisman Bertazi wrote:
> The Error info type is a record sent to users on FAN_FS_ERROR events
> documenting the type of error. It also carries an error count,
> documenting how many errors were observed since the last reporting.
>
> Signed-off-by: Gabriel Krisman Bertazi <krisman@collabora.com>
Looks good. Feel free to add:
Reviewed-by: Jan Kara <jack@suse.cz>

>
> ---
> Changes since v5:
> - Move error code here
> ---
> f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ify.c | 1 +
> f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ify.h | 1 +
> f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ify_user.c | 36 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
> include/uapi/linux/fanotify.h | 7 ++++++
> 4 files changed, 45 insertions(+)
>
> diff --git a/f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ify.c b/f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ify.c
> index f5c16ac37835..b49a474c1d7f 100644
> --- a/f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ify.c
> +++ b/f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ify.c
> @@ -745,6 +745,7 @@ static int fanotify_handle_error_event(struct fsnotify_iter_info *iter_info,
> spin_unlock(&group->notification_lock);
>
> fee->fae.type = FANOTIFY_EVENT_TYPE_FS_ERROR;
> + fee->error = report->error;
> fee->fsid = fee->sb_mark->fsn_mark.connector->fsid;
>
> fh_len = fanotify_encode_fh_len(inode);
> diff --git a/f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ify.h b/f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ify.h
> index 158cf0c4b0bd..0cfe376c6fd9 100644
> --- a/f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ify.h
> +++ b/f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ify.h
> @@ -220,6 +220,7 @@ FANOTIFY_NE(struct fanotify_event *event)
>
> struct fanotify_error_event {
> struct fanotify_event fae;
> + s32 error; /* Error reported by the Filesystem. */
> u32 err_count; /* Suppressed errors count */
>
> struct fanotify_sb_mark *sb_mark; /* Back reference to the mark. */
> diff --git a/f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ify_user.c b/f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ify_user.c
> index 1ab8f9d8b3ac..ca53159ce673 100644
> --- a/f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ify_user.c
> +++ b/fs/notify/fanotify/fanotify_user.c
> @@ -107,6 +107,8 @@ struct kmem_cache *fanotify_perm_event_cachep __read_mostly;
> #define FANOTIFY_EVENT_ALIGN 4
> #define FANOTIFY_INFO_HDR_LEN \
> (sizeof(struct fanotify_event_info_fid) + sizeof(struct file_handle))
> +#define FANOTIFY_INFO_ERROR_LEN \
> + (sizeof(struct fanotify_event_info_error))
>
> static int fanotify_fid_info_len(int fh_len, int name_len)
> {
> @@ -130,6 +132,9 @@ static size_t fanotify_event_len(struct fanotify_event *event,
> if (!fid_mode)
> return event_len;
>
> + if (fanotify_is_error_event(event->mask))
> + event_len += FANOTIFY_INFO_ERROR_LEN;
> +
> info = fanotify_event_info(event);
> dir_fh_len = fanotify_event_dir_fh_len(event);
> fh_len = fanotify_event_object_fh_len(event);
> @@ -176,6 +181,7 @@ static struct fanotify_event *fanotify_dup_error_to_stack(
> error_on_stack->fae.type = FANOTIFY_EVENT_TYPE_FS_ERROR;
> error_on_stack->err_count = fee->err_count;
> error_on_stack->sb_mark = fee->sb_mark;
> + error_on_stack->error = fee->error;
>
> error_on_stack->fsid = fee->fsid;
>
> @@ -342,6 +348,28 @@ static int process_access_response(struct fsnotify_group *group,
> return -ENOENT;
> }
>
> +static size_t copy_error_info_to_user(struct fanotify_event *event,
> + char __user *buf, int count)
> +{
> + struct fanotify_event_info_error info;
> + struct fanotify_error_event *fee = FANOTIFY_EE(event);
> +
> + info.hdr.info_type = FAN_EVENT_INFO_TYPE_ERROR;
> + info.hdr.pad = 0;
> + info.hdr.len = FANOTIFY_INFO_ERROR_LEN;
> +
> + if (WARN_ON(count < info.hdr.len))
> + return -EFAULT;
> +
> + info.error = fee->error;
> + info.error_count = fee->err_count;
> +
> + if (copy_to_user(buf, &info, sizeof(info)))
> + return -EFAULT;
> +
> + return info.hdr.len;
> +}
> +
> static int copy_info_to_user(__kernel_fsid_t *fsid, struct fanotify_fh *fh,
> int info_type, const char *name, size_t name_len,
> char __user *buf, size_t count)
> @@ -505,6 +533,14 @@ static ssize_t copy_event_to_user(struct fsnotify_group *group,
> if (f)
> fd_install(fd, f);
>
> + if (fanotify_is_error_event(event->mask)) {
> + ret = copy_error_info_to_user(event, buf, count);
> + if (ret < 0)
> + goto out_close_fd;
> + buf += ret;
> + count -= ret;
> + }
> +
> /* Event info records order is: dir fid + name, child fid */
> if (fanotify_event_dir_fh_len(event)) {
> info_type = info->name_len ? FAN_EVENT_INFO_TYPE_DFID_NAME :
> diff --git a/include/uapi/linux/fanotify.h b/include/uapi/linux/fanotify.h
> index 16402037fc7a..80040a92e9d9 100644
> --- a/include/uapi/linux/fanotify.h
> +++ b/include/uapi/linux/fanotify.h
> @@ -124,6 +124,7 @@ struct fanotify_event_metadata {
> #define FAN_EVENT_INFO_TYPE_FID 1
> #define FAN_EVENT_INFO_TYPE_DFID_NAME 2
> #define FAN_EVENT_INFO_TYPE_DFID 3
> +#define FAN_EVENT_INFO_TYPE_ERROR 4
>
> /* Variable length info record following event metadata */
> struct fanotify_event_info_header {
> @@ -149,6 +150,12 @@ struct fanotify_event_info_fid {
> unsigned char handle[0];
> };
>
> +struct fanotify_event_info_error {
> + struct fanotify_event_info_header hdr;
> + __s32 error;
> + __u32 error_count;
> +};
> +
> struct fanotify_response {
> __s32 fd;
> __u32 response;
> --
> 2.32.0
>
